The last time Southern Miss unveiled a new logo, it ended up in a lawsuit with Iowa for trademark infringement. That version of the Southern Miss logo purportedly had a “fierce eyed gaze of independence,” according to the school. Those fierce eyes were white around the iris, though, because Golden Eagles are traditionally fierce.
